HB273 - Electric Bicycle Regulation Summary
-
Defines electric bicycles with three classes based on motor power (less than 750 watts) and maximum assisted speed: Class 1 (20 mph), Class 2 (20 mph throttle), and Class 3 (28 mph).
-
Exempts electric bicycles and their operators from driver licensing, registration, insurance, and motor vehicle dealer requirements.
-
Requires manufacturers to apply permanent labels to electric bicycles by January 1, 2021, containing classification number, top assisted speed, and motor wattage.
-
Prohibits tampering with electric bicycles to change motor speed without updating required labels and mandates all Class 3 riders wear helmets and use speedometers.
-
Allows local jurisdictions to restrict Class 1 and Class 2 electric bicycles on paths for safety reasons and permits Class 3 restrictions; excludes natural surface trails from these restrictions.
